Back in 1977, Cul du Sac was a trailblazer. Not far from Piazza Navona, this narrow enoteca pioneered the next generation of wine bars around the world. Today she’s the great grandmother; a friendly classic serving authentic Romen cuisine. Trippa (beef tripe), oxtail and involtini (Romen roulades) compliment well the 1,500 wines on the shelves above guests’ heads just waiting to be uncorked. The clientele and charming service reflect the bars many years of success. At midday, business people who trade in pleasure, intellectuals from the neighborhood and a few travelers gather together on the terrace to catch some sun. The Cul de Sac is a good evening choice if your lunch was generous enough that a few good glasses of wine along with a nice, well matched selection of cheeses and pâtés will suffice. The påtés are all homemade and are favorites of the guests.
